Brad Widstrom’s human puppy left him. To keep his mind off his loneliness, he drills all his extra time into coaching his kickball team. After a game one night, he goes to a pet-play party. He doesn’t expect to meet someone who makes his blood sizzle. The thing is, the man he wants isn’t a puppy, he’s a cat. Brad doesn’t know the first thing about them. One thing is certain, though, and that’s how much he wants Harley.

Harley Silvain is used to being ignored. Owners prefer the friendlier pet — dogs, not cats — and Harley is anything but sociable. There’s something pleasing about having an owner take care of him, but he’s not sure about this new man, Brad. Harley keeps waiting for Brad to decide he’s too much work. He’s sure he’ll be replaced by a mutt.

When Brad’s friend asks him to take in a pup who has been abused by his owner, Harley hates the idea. It’s one step closer to Brad dropping him, and he’s not willing to let a canine in the house. No matter how many times Brad reassures Harley he’d never leave him for a dog, Harley doesn’t believe it. If they want to make this relationship work, Brad will need to help Harley past his insecurities, or it’ll implode before it even begins.

This was a nice variation on puppy play. I’ve read a couple of books with pet play in them but never one where the characters were so immersed into it. Harley’s human personality is very much like a cats and so the transition from person to feline worked really well. There is a nice hurt/comfort to the story and Brad should be given either a gold star or an award on patience. Slow burn in the romance.

It’s the first time I’ve listened to Christopher Solon and he did a very nice job of character voices. He had Harley sounding snobbish at the start of the story, insecure in the middle and content at the end. All done with the right inflection. He also was really good voicing Quan’s hyper personality.
